gir1.2-secret-1: Secret store (GObject-Introspection)

 This package contains introspection data for libsecret, which can be used
 to generate dynamic bindings.
 .
 libsecret is a library for storing and retrieving passwords and other secrets.
 It communicates with the "Secret Service" using DBus.
